Raikkonen expecting Lotus to fight back

After a few below par race weekends, Kimi Raikkonen is expecting Lotus to fight back to the front at the British Grand Prix. The Finn admitted that Monaco and Canada were more about 'surviving not attacking' and that's not where he wants to be. Three points in the last two races is not what he was expecting but he feels that returning to permanent track venues – rather than street tracks – will suit their car better. Speaking about the past few races in a team statement, he said: 'Obviously, it's not been that great and we haven't got the results we wanted.
